Commit Graph

3383 Commits

Author SHA1 Message Date
haw8411 6553b08820 NFC: Add Mifare Ultralight C Write Support (#524)
* Updated Ultralight C Poller & Other Files to support Ultralight C Write

* Delete ulcwrite.patch

* Removed Cache, fixed nits, and fixed clang-format

* Remove dead target_uid fields (cache removed)

* Fix issues WillyJL suggested

* Fix aaronjamt's code suggestions

* Fix malloc suggestion

* Remove furi_log

* Update changelog

---------

Co-authored-by: haw8411 <hawillis84@icloud.com>
Co-authored-by: WillyJL <me@willyjl.dev>
2026-03-09 00:22:09 +01:00
WillyJL 97617404d7 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2026-03-08 23:39:43 +01:00
MX 6d68b37b53 subghz fix very big issue with tx on read screen 2026-03-08 20:17:26 +03:00
WillyJL 3c1cbe39d0 Fix #include'd C files by mistake 2026-03-01 01:28:12 +01:00
WillyJL 853ccce7dd Merge remote-tracking branch 'ul/dev' into mntm-dev 2026-02-28 22:05:49 +01:00
WillyJL 353aea6cd0 Merge commit '9aacbf943c458df1db94c05c0c08cc87bbc93bb0' into mntm-dev 2026-02-28 21:25:13 +01:00
WillyJL 50c0154e7f Merge commit 'e681fd2be571523f251ff688351a9299aa533ad4' into mntm-dev 2026-02-28 21:21:09 +01:00
WillyJL 22357e292d Merge commit '0032c55a39ca402f7b1ecbac4b52275298d2b8ef' into mntm-dev 2026-02-28 21:11:12 +01:00
WillyJL 6dbdcbe3de Merge commit '48db77f307c2b998a34e99317e7a8add0c9e7d18' into mntm-dev 2026-02-28 21:03:06 +01:00
WillyJL 24a988030d Merge commit '97eaee54c8f12c0103487c7c5c8df6ba0b538e12' into mntm-dev 2026-02-28 20:26:37 +01:00
WillyJL 4a8364904f Merge commit '95dd537bf81ee445b1fb71aa60431cb62080333d' into mntm-dev 2026-02-28 19:53:57 +01:00
WillyJL 6dc6fcbaab Merge commit '484ea661f1032276bf937ceb83fa2311c41ba9f4' into mntm-dev 2026-02-28 19:45:12 +01:00
MX 556a2dd3f6 subghz: add ditec gol4 protocol
by @xMasterX (MMX) & @zero-mega
2026-02-28 05:29:03 +03:00
MX 317838eaf4 fix keytis key generation 2026-02-22 20:33:13 +03:00
MX 56620ab62f subghz somfy keytis button switch and add manually support 2026-02-22 19:44:57 +03:00
Dmitry422 9700c98c38 Small refactor Signal Settings for best user expirience.
Save and apply counter mode immidiatly after changing,
without exit from signal_settings menu.
2026-02-15 22:35:47 +07:00
MX 75d4263822 fix endless tx state at receiver info 2026-02-15 16:39:58 +03:00
MX 9eb8e475cc fix switching, etc. 2026-02-12 20:24:32 +03:00
MX 343c2c2118 Merge branch 'dev' into leeroy_dev 2026-02-12 18:52:23 +03:00
Leeroy c6421c9fff REFACTOR: Tx power fixes (Use 1 array, dont play with Weird Custom Presets) 2026-02-12 21:42:03 +11:00
Leeroy 14269286eb TX Power: Use correct Offset and Values for FM PA table. 2026-02-12 18:04:53 +11:00
MX 48db77f307 fix settings [ci skip] 2026-02-10 00:32:20 +03:00
MX e96b38da36 fmt 2026-02-10 00:21:44 +03:00
MX 273aa1b807 don't use much bits for 8bit values [ci skip] 2026-02-10 00:11:52 +03:00
Leeroy 168240c237 TX POWER: Move from Receiver Config to Radio Settings 2026-02-08 14:17:04 +11:00
Leeroy e0c1a89c5d Refactor: Replace 2 assignments with one-liner 2026-02-07 22:00:19 +11:00
Leeroy a515f435fc UNLEASHED:: TX Power setting to SubGhz App
* Works in Read, and Read RAW.
* You can now adjust the TX power for testing devices without desyncing them from inside
* Lets you do RTL testing etc on very low power.

CODE REFACTORED, subghz_txrx_set_tx_power added.
2026-02-06 23:58:20 +11:00
Dmitry422 162f9d3da3 clean 2026-02-05 18:16:31 +07:00
Dmitry422 80158e84a2 subgh rpc refactor to "one click send signal" 2026-02-05 18:04:42 +07:00
MX 67e191b135 Keeloq ultimate, and some fixes and improvements [ci skip]
- fix repeat values
- fix endless tx missing
- add mode 7 aka counter bypass
- take some ram
- free some ram
- fix comments
2026-02-05 01:13:48 +03:00
Dmitry422 e4aac3dbc6 Merge branch 'dev' of https://github.com/Dmitry422/unleashed-firmware into dev 2026-02-02 01:22:47 +07:00
Dmitry422 1d32d1de5c btn_is_available = true 2026-02-02 01:22:39 +07:00
Dmitry422 d0bfce5fdd Merge branch 'DarkFlippers:dev' into dev 2026-02-01 10:03:56 +07:00
MX 95dd537bf8 add v2 phox counter modes support 2026-02-01 05:51:09 +03:00
Dmitry422 0eae6030b0 work to home 2026-01-30 22:15:48 +07:00
MX dfb17ab428 Revert "Merge pull request #949 from Dmitry422/dev"
This reverts commit ae1abd6139, reversing
changes made to a8d5743cf6.
2026-01-26 14:14:06 +03:00
MX 7fa5624c50 Revert "start working with subghz button editor"
This reverts commit 14abc959cf.
2026-01-26 12:45:57 +03:00
Dmitry422 14abc959cf start working with subghz button editor 2026-01-26 16:31:07 +07:00
Dmitry422 6bf2a6cb68 Merge branch 'DarkFlippers:dev' into dev 2026-01-26 16:25:19 +07:00
MX 271c65a969 subghz: add jarolift protocol
and various fixes
2026-01-26 11:51:28 +03:00
Dmitry422 3cc57f7b3e Subghz send by one touch 2026-01-26 13:14:49 +07:00
Leeroy c94b5505b7 Archive: Support opening and pinning ProtoPirate files from Archive (#510)
* ProtoPirate added to known apps, can use browser and favorites to Open PSFs now.

* Archive: Use protopirate icon for .psf files

* Update changelog

* Format

---------

Co-authored-by: WillyJL <me@willyjl.dev>
2026-01-25 23:46:52 +01:00
WillyJL e512d6ca91 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2026-01-25 21:46:32 +01:00
Dmitry422 8a85ab88a7 Home to work 2026-01-25 22:38:11 +07:00
Dmitry422 267140b161 work to home 2026-01-23 18:59:14 +07:00
WillyJL dfca4f8ec5 Merge remote-tracking branch 'ul/dev' into mntm-dev --nobuild 2026-01-21 23:31:53 +01:00
MX d73d0f7fbd various ui/ux changes
text spacing reduced from 4px to 3px
some text was replaced
2026-01-21 22:49:07 +03:00
MX 3f85bea80d fix slix unlock color 2026-01-21 19:55:15 +03:00
MX 28bc7b0569 fix slix unlock scene led not blinking 2026-01-21 09:12:04 +03:00
MX 5bf0a7dbc5 subghz: smol fixes 2026-01-21 07:59:05 +03:00